3 Duplicity most nearly means:
61% Answer Correctly
deferment
accommodate
discern
deceit

Solution
The definition for duplicity is "Deceptive thought, speech, or action." Used in a sentence: The life of an undercover detective is filed with necessary duplicity. The definition for accommodate is "to give consideration to.", the definition for discern is "To recognize as separate as distinct.", and the definition for deferment is "The act of delaying."

4 Interminable most nearly means:
68% Answer Correctly
serenity
ceaseless
scamper
turpitude

Solution
The definition for interminable is "Never ending, or seemingly endless." Used in a sentence: The impatient Zoe found the longwinded lecture interminable. The definition for serenity is "calmness.", the definition for turpitude is "Essential baseness, depravity.", and the definition for scamper is "To run quickly."

5 Scamper most nearly means:
77% Answer Correctly
catastrophic
proximity
methodical
dash

Solution
The definition for scamper is "To run quickly." Used in a sentence: The frightened kitten scampered away from the butterfly. The definition for catastrophic is "relating to extreme misfortune.", the definition for proximity is "Closeness.", and the definition for methodical is "Performed in an orderly manner."
